TURN-208: Gatevale turnstile counters at the Merrow Field pilot double-count when a rotation reverses mid-cycle. Attendance totals drift roughly 2% high per event. The debounce window fix is implemented, reviewed by Ilsa, and soak-tested across two simulated match days without drift. Ready for your cut; the candidate build is identified below.

trace token, tagag-tafog: htk6_5ed18c

Ticket: Nightly backfill scheduler — needs sign-off. Hey reviewer, this adds the new cron-style scheduler for the Driftwell backfills so we stop kicking them off by hand at 2am. It handles overlapping runs, skips nights where the upstream feed is late, and logs everything to the usual place. Code-wise it's pretty contained, but since it touches production data pipelines we need a formal sign-off before merge. The one person authorized to give that sign-off is named below.

approver of hahig-kahap = Fraeth Nordor Normir

## Onboarding: Farebranch Rules Engine

Plugin authors integrate with Farebranch by registering fee rules against the evaluation API. Rules are sandboxed; they cannot perform network calls directly. All rate-table lookups go through the host, which validates your plugin manifest at load time. Your local env file must include the signing credential the host uses to verify manifests, set on the next line.

secret setting of bajef-fajof: COURIER_KEY3=76c

## Changelog — Verdansa Controller 3.2

Changed defaults: sensor drift compensation is now enabled out of the box. Humidity and temperature probes are recalibrated against the rolling baseline every six hours instead of daily, and drift beyond tolerance raises a soft alert rather than silently clamping. Plugin authors relying on raw readings should note the new defaults listed below.

settings of fafog-haduf:
ZORIX_PIN=4648
ZORIX_METRICS_HOST=metrics.zorix.paliqsys.corp
ZORIX_LOG_LEVEL=info
ZORIX_TENANT=druix